Bio-Data

Prof Hemayun Akhtar Nazmi, PhD Centre for West Asian studies

Jamia Millia Islamia New Delhi -110025

Email: hnazmi@jmi.ac.in Tel: 0091-9810710350

Dr Hemayun Akhtar Nazmi working as Professor at the Centre for West Asian Studies since December 1, 2020. Prior to that, he was Associate Professor and Assistant Professor at the same centre from December 1, 2005. Before joining JMI, he worked as a Documentation Officer at the Gulf Studies Programme, Centre for West Asian and African Studies, School of International Studies, Jawaharlal Nehru University, New Delhi-110057.

Prof. H A Nazmi is a noted scholar of Arab and Islamic Studies. He has PhD from the Department of Islamic Studies and a double M.A. both in Arabic & Islamic Studies from Jawaharlal Nehru University and Jamia Millia Islamia, New Delhi. His M.Phil. from Centre for West Asian Studies, School of International Studies, Jawaharlal Nehru University. He was a Visiting Fellow at the MSH (June 2006) under the Indo-French Cultural Exchange Programme.

His expertise includes the history and Culture of the Arab World, Indo- Arab relations especially with the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ia, Global Perspective of Islam, Various dimensions of Islamism in the West Asian region, Islamic Movements in West Asia, Historical materials in Indian Archives and Libraries on West Asia.

He is teaching various courses like ‘Religion, Culture and Society in

West Asia’, ‘History and Culture of Saudi Arabia and Introduction to

West Asia to M. Phil and Ph. D Students. He is also teaching the courses

to the M.A students in M.A International Relations - West Asian

(2)

Studies, 1. Society and Culture in West Asia, 2. Islam and Islamism in West Asia, 3. History and Foreign Policy of Saudi Arabia, 4. Leaders in West Asia, 5. Intellectual Development in the Arab world. A course named ‘Global Perspective of Islam, teaching to the MA students of CBCS.

Prof. H A Nazmi has organized a number of Seminars/ Conferences on various topics and the most important one is 1. Indian Archives and Libraries as a Source for the Arab Gulf History in 2009, 2. ‘The Role of Higher Education in Inter Cultural Dialogue and Strengthen the World Peace in 2015.

Prof. Nazmi has several research papers and books to his credit. He has authored/edited five books on various aspects of Arab society and culture like ‘India and Saudi Arabia: The Emerging Socio-Cultural and Economic Dimension’, ‘Contemporary West Asia: The Emerging Scenario’ etc. He has also supervised more than 30 research scholars (6 Ph. D, 25 M. Phil) on various aspects of Arab society and Culture. At present, several scholars are working under his supervision.
